Problem

Existing malfunction detection methods in production machines, such as those with motors, often result in false positives when the machine has been idle for a long period, leading to unnecessary maintenance due to increased viscosity of lubricating oils and other operational conditions unrelated to motor performance.

Innovation Solution

A malfunction determination method and device that assesses the operation history of a production machine to identify prolonged stop periods, setting a suspension period for malfunction detection to prevent false alarms, using sensor data like torque and vibration values, and determining malfunctions only outside this period.

Data Source

PatentUS11518034B2Malfunction determination method and malfunction determination device
Publication Date: 2022.12.06 NISSAN MOTOR CO LTD

AI summary

A malfunction determination method for a production machine including a motor as a driving source of a rotating mechanism acquires sensor data of a sensor for detecting a condition of the production machine, determines whether the production machine has an operation stop period during which the production machine has stopped its operation for a predetermined period of time or longer in accordance with an operation history of the production machine, sets a malfunction determination suspension period for suspending a malfunction determination of the production machine when determined to have the operation stop period, in accordance with a length of the operation stop period, and determines whether the production machine has a malfunction in a period other than the malfunction determination suspension period.
